A lumbar puncture, also known as a spinal tap, is a medical procedure used to collect c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) from the spinal canal for diagnostic or therapeutic purposes. During the procedure, a needle is inserted into the lower back, specifically into the lumbar region of the spine, between two vertebrae, to access the CSF. This fluid surrounds the brain and spinal cord and can provide valuable information about the central nervous system's health. Lumbar punctures are commonly indicated for diagnosing conditions such as meningitis, encephalitis, multiple sclerosis, and other neurological disorders. They are also used to measure the pressure of the cerebrospinal fluid and to administer certain medications or contrast agents. Symptoms that may lead to a lumbar puncture include persistent headaches, unexplained neurological symptoms, or signs of infection such as fever and neck stiffness. Complications from a lumbar puncture are relatively rare but can occur. The most common complication is a headache, known as a post-lumbar puncture headache, which can result from a loss of CSF following the procedure. Other potential complications include infection at the puncture site, bleeding, and in rare cases, damage to the spinal cord or nerves. Some patients may also experience back pain or discomfort at the needle insertion site. Severe complications, such as brain herniation, are very rare but can occur if there is a significant increase in intracranial pressure or if the procedure is performed incorrectly.
Preparation for a lumbar puncture typically involves ensuring the patient is well-hydrated and may include fasting or avoiding certain medications that could affect the procedure. After the procedure, patients are usually advised to lie flat for a period to minimize the risk of headaches and to drink plenty of fluids. Most individuals recover quickly, though some may experience temporary discomfort. A lumbar puncture is a valuable diagnostic tool that provides critical insights into central nervous system conditions, helping to guide effective treatment strategies.
